Take a look at this new trailer for Little Big Planet, a game for the Playstation3. It starts with a reference to the Dutch game ‘Killzone’. It looks real fun to make your own content and to build levels.

Players can use their abilities to shape and develop the highly manipulable environment to build custom spaces either individually, collaboratively, and/or competitively. Levels focus on co-operative, physics-based gameplay, and players can use mechanisms such as cogs and blocks to build anything from small level parts to large, complex worlds. The game will also allow opportunities for players to acquire new skills and tools. A major focus of LittleBigPlanet will be on the global community features through the PlayStation Network for players to interact and share their “patches” – levels and other modifications – as well as online play.


It is due for release in October 2008. The game’s physics engine looks pretty realistic.

And physics seem to be real hot. I was just playing ‘Boomblox’ on the Nintendo Wii, a Steven Spielberg / EA game where there’s also a big role for physics. The objective of the game is to knock a structure made of blox over, so that all the blox fall. Or the other way around, pretty much the same as the old school Jenga (which means ‘to build’).
